Yet another free lunchtime maritime concert at Hull's Maritime Museum.

This is the third such concert and the previous ones were well subscribed. It will take place in the main gallery this time where we had the first one, so plenty of room and wonderful acoustics.

The line-up is once again
Paul and Liz Davenport
Hissyfit
Ralph and Helene Marks
Sam Martin
Spare Hands

Paul and Liz, Hissyfit and Spare Hands all have new CDs to promote.

Concert runs from 11 am to 2 pm and then all off to City to watch them beat Newcastle.

Another great concert. All seats taken and others standing, people coming backwards and forwards wandering through the Museum, most staying for a while. Old friends from out of town turning up who only heard about it the night before. Some great performances once again and thanks to a very appreciative audience.

Paul pointed out a painting of the Kearsage and the Alabama around the corner so we sang Roll, Alabama, Roll.

Here's to the next one.
